  • Patent number: 4961667
    Abstract: A maintenance-free pivot joint is disclosed for mounting a first member of a loader linkage to a second member thereof. The first member is provided with a clevis having a pair of brackets. The pivot joint includes a pivot pin which is pivotally mounted within the second loader linkage member. A first end collar is fixedly secured to one end of the pivot pin of the joint and is slidably mounted to a first one of the pair of brackets. Conversely, a second end collar is slidably mounted on the other end of the pin and fixedly secured to a second of the brackets, but at a preselectable axial position relative to the second member. The positioning of the second end collar at the preselected position allows the joint to accommodate lateral misalignment between the first and second members of the linkage, while maintaining a closely spaced lateral relationship therebetween to eliminate end play and facilitate good sealability.
